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8797 27975749 1773104
23 79634987593
23 79634987593
621 72 71537567634 294 050939
All about undefined
Interested in learning more?
23 79634987593
621 72 71537567634 294 050939
See more
692452474 37337294994 78000550
37665449805 284067611 04858
See more
38765 52778 121
42425 186160 93
See more